Abstract
A device for monitoring crop diseases and insect pests and generating a pesticide prescription comprises hardware equipment and a software algorithm program. Under the control of a computer, a camera and a pesticide detector are used for monitoring crops in real time, monitoring signals are digitalized and then enter a computer database, and image feature extraction pest pattern recognition processing and separation component feature extraction pesticide pattern recognition processing are carried out on the monitoring data by a computer program according to information and knowledge in a pest characteristic database, a pesticide characteristic database, a pest control historical database, a pesticide use historical database, a pest control knowledge base and a pesticide knowledge base respectively to obtain pest type degree information and pesticide residue component concentration information; carrying out information fusion processing to obtain comprehensive relevant information such as the drug resistance of the disease and pest occurrence and development conditions; and (3) carrying out knowledge reasoning intelligent decision to generate an optimal pest control pesticide prescription, thereby achieving the purposes of automatic monitoring and scientific control of crop pests.

Embodiment
As shown in Figure 1, the hardware device of diseases and pests of agronomic crop monitoring and pesticide prescription generating apparatus comprises video camera 1, video signal preprocessor 2, video digitizer 3, Video Controller 4, Pesticides Testing instrument 5, separated component signal processor 6, digitizer 7, sampling controller 8, calculator 9 and internet access facility 10, the structure of this device are that an available wire connects the dispersed structure that also available wireless signal transmission connects.
The monitor signal flow process of hardware device is: the monitor signal of video camera 1 is converted into data signal by video digitizer 3 and enters calculator 9 through lead or through wireless transmission after video signal preprocessor 2 carries out preliminary treatment; The monitor signal of Pesticides Testing instrument 5 is converted into data signal by digitizer 7 and enters calculator 9 through lead or through wireless transmission after separated component signal processor 6 carries out preliminary treatment, and calculator 9 inserts the internet through internet access facility 10.
The control signal flow process of hardware device is: described Video Controller 4 is subjected to the control of calculator 9, produces the duty of control signal corresponding control video camera 1, video signal preprocessor 2 and video digitizer 3; Described sampling controller 8 is subjected to the control of calculator 9, produces the duty of control signal corresponding control Pesticides Testing instrument 5, separated component signal processor 6 and digitizer 7.
As shown in Figure 2, the software algorithm program of diseases and pests of agronomic crop monitoring and pesticide prescription generating apparatus comprises crop map image data 11, separated component detects data 12, multimedia database 13, separated component database 14, multi-medium data preliminary treatment 15, separated component data preliminary treatment 16, damage by disease and insect property data base 17, image feature extraction damage by disease and insect pattern-recognition 18, separated component feature extraction agricultural chemicals pattern-recognition 19, agricultural chemicals property data base 20, pest species degree information 21, residue of pesticide component concentration information 22, extermination of disease and insect pest historical data base 23, information fusion handles 24, agricultural chemicals uses historical data base 25, extermination of disease and insect pest knowledge base 26, knowledge reasoning intelligent decision 27, agricultural chemicals knowledge base 28, agricultural machinery control parameter 29, pesticide prescription 30, long-distance user's diagnosis consulting 31.
The software algorithm program flow characteristics that is used for diseases and pests of agronomic crop monitoring and pesticide prescription generating apparatus of described calculator 9 operations is to comprise the following steps:
(1) video camera 1 from aerial or ground in the face of the plant of crops, comprise stem, leaf, flower, really, skin and insect carry out optics shooting and sequential image acquisition at interval, the crop map image data 11 of acquisition deposits in the multimedia database 13 of calculator 9;
(2) farm chemical ingredients and concentration detection are carried out in 5 pairs of crops environment of Pesticides Testing instrument and surface, and the separated component of acquisition detects data 12 and deposits in the separated component database 14 of calculator 9;
(3) starting algorithm program multi-medium data preliminary treatment 15 and separated component data preliminary treatment 16 respectively carried out data to the Monitoring Data in multimedia database 13 and the separated component database 14 and handled, and removes data noise, eliminates vacancy data etc.;
(4) the damage by disease and insect feature on the crops is extracted in starting algorithm program image feature extraction damage by disease and insect pattern-recognition 18, carries out characteristic matching identification with damage by disease and insect property data base 17 and handles, and obtains pest species degree information 21;
(5) pattern-recognition of starting algorithm program separated component feature extraction agricultural chemicals 19, extract the separated component data characteristics, carry out characteristic matching identification with agricultural chemicals property data base 20 and handle, and obtain residue of pesticide component concentration information 22;
(6) starting algorithm program information fusion treatment 24, use the information of historical data base 25 according to extermination of disease and insect pest historical data base 23 and agricultural chemicals, pest species degree information 21 and residue of pesticide component concentration information 22 to monitoring are carried out information fusion processing 24, obtain comprehensive relevant informations such as damage by disease and insect generation state of development pesticide resistance;
(7) starting algorithm program knowledge reasoning intelligent decision 27, according to the knowledge in extermination of disease and insect pest knowledge base 26 and the agricultural chemicals knowledge base 28, generate best scientific and reasonable extermination of disease and insect pest pesticide prescription 30;
(8) contain in this pesticide prescription 30 and be useful on control agricultural machinery and carry out optimum agricultural chemicals proportioning, the agricultural machinery of spraying operation control parameter 29, and the knowledge and the information that can be used to carry out long-distance user's diagnosis consulting 31.
Video camera 1 and the Pesticides Testing instrument 5 common front end signals of forming the diseases and pests of agronomic crop monitor obtain part in the described hardware device, and detecting data is the initial data that the algorithm routine in the calculator 9 is handled.
Image feature extraction damage by disease and insect pattern-recognition 18 in the described software algorithm program, be that the image feature extraction algorithm routine is the sequence image to crops, carrying out the feature extraction of shape, size, texture and color handles, extract the damage by disease and insect characteristic information on the crops, damage by disease and insect algorithm for pattern recognition program is carried out characteristic matching identification processing with damage by disease and insect characteristic information and damage by disease and insect property data base 17, obtains pest species degree information 21.
Separated component feature extraction agricultural chemicals pattern-recognition 19 in the described software algorithm program, be that separated component Feature Extraction Algorithm program is to organic extraction, physical excitation and enrichment, the intensification organic components is separated the data of some processes acquisitions and is carried out the feature extraction processing, agricultural chemicals algorithm for pattern recognition program is carried out characteristic matching identification processing with separated component feature and the agricultural chemicals property data base 20 that extracts, and obtains residue of pesticide component concentration information 22.
Described software algorithm program information fusion treatment 24, be the historical experience information of using historical data base 25 according to extermination of disease and insect pest historical data base 23 and agricultural chemicals, pest species degree information 21 and residue of pesticide component concentration information 22 to monitoring are carried out data qualification, excavation and correlation analysis processing, obtain damage by disease and insect generation, state of development and pesticide resistance integrated information.
Described software algorithm program knowledge reasoning intelligent decision 27, be that the knowledge reasoning algorithm routine is to handling the 24 comprehensive relevant informations of obtaining of damage by disease and insect generation, state of development and pesticide resistance through information fusion, according to the knowledge in extermination of disease and insect pest knowledge base 26 and the agricultural chemicals knowledge base 28, logical derivation goes out extermination of disease and insect pest pesticide prescription, and intelligent decision generates scientific and reasonable pesticide prescription 30.
